Coffee milk tea recipe, a fusion that brings together the bold flavors of coffee and the comforting qualities of tea in a single cup

In a small saucepan, combine whole milk, black tea leaves, and pure maple syrup. Heat the mixture over medium heat until it reaches a gentle simmer. Remove the saucepan from the heat and allow the mixture to come to room temperature.

Brew the espresso using your preferred method. Let the espresso cool to room temperature. Once both the milk tea and espresso have reached room temperature, refrigerate until chilled (at least 1 hour).

When ready to serve, fill a glass with ice cubes, pour the chilled espresso over the ice, then pour the cooled milk tea into the glass over the espresso. Give it a gentle stir to combine the flavors and enjoy cold.

For a hot coffee milk tea, just pour the tea mixture and shot of espresso while still hot into a cup, and enjoy warm
